Practical Details

Setauket Scramble Scavenger Hunt - Practical Details

  • Meeting point: Starbucks at 246 NY-25A, Setauket-East Setauket, NY 11733
  • Duration: About 2 hours, making it easy to slot into a busy day
  • Cost: $27 per person, which is a reasonable price for a personalized, interactive experience
  • Accessibility: Most travelers can participate; service animals are allowed
  • Group size: Max 30 travelers, maintaining a lively but manageable group
  • Booking: Mobile tickets available, with free cancellation up to 24 hours in advance

FAQ

How long does the Setauket Scramble take?
The activity lasts approximately 2 hours, which makes it a perfect quick outing or a fun way to break up your day.

Where does the tour start and end?
It begins at Starbucks located at 246 NY-25A, Setauket, and finishes back at the same spot, so you don’t have to worry about transportation back and forth.

Is it suitable for children or dogs?
Yes, both family-friendly and dog-friendly, making it a flexible activity for various groups.

What is included in the cost?
Your payment covers the digital quest, the guidance of a live remote host, and access to challenges and checkpoints. No hidden fees are mentioned.

Can I participate if I don’t like using my phone?
The experience relies on your phone for receiving clues, texting photos, and interacting with your host, so it’s best suited for those comfortable with smartphone use.

Is there any physical requirement?
Participants will walk or drive to different locations, so comfortable shoes and mobility are recommended. The activity balances indoor and outdoor parts, but no strenuous activity is specified.
